SubTotals
I have a Macro that takes current subtotal in a range and removes them.
However, the Macro Stop and gives me a Message Box telling me that "Entire SubTotal will be deleted" Choice of OK or Cancel. How can I have it not ask me this and just automatically run remove the SubTotal? The line simple reads as follows: Selection.RemoveSubtotal Range("F8:AA321").Select -- MJM |

Just under the start of the Sub:
Application.DisplayAlerts = False Just before the end of the Sub Application.DisplayAlerts = True Regards, Ryan--- -- RyGuy "MikeM" wrote: I have a Macro that takes current subtotal in a range and removes them.
